Company Overview

FormFactor, Inc. (NASDAQ:FORM) is a leading provider of advanced test and measurement solutions for the semiconductor industry. The company specializes in the design, development and manufacture of high-performance wafer-level and package-level test interfaces used in wafer sort, characterization, reliability and failure analysis applications. By leveraging precision microelectromechanical systems (MEMS) and photolithographic processes, FormFactor delivers probe cards, analytical probes and test sockets that enable device makers to validate next-generation integrated circuits across logic, memory, RF, analog and power applications.

FormFactor’s product portfolio includes custom probe cards for wafer probers, TEM-based analytical probes for material and device characterization, and socket solutions for burn-in and final test of packaged devices. The company’s engineering teams work closely with semiconductor manufacturers, foundries and advanced packaging houses to tailor test interfaces to specific device geometries, test environments and throughput requirements. FormFactor also provides turnkey test floor support, including probe station integration, maintenance services and data-driven performance optimization.

Headquartered in Livermore, California, FormFactor maintains R&D, manufacturing and service facilities in key semiconductor markets throughout North America, Europe and Asia. The company supports customers in Taiwan, South Korea, Japan, China and other regions, ensuring global coverage for both high-volume production and research-oriented environments. Since its inception, FormFactor has focused on innovation in test technology, working to address the evolving needs of advanced process nodes, heterogeneous integration and emerging device architectures.
